Network independence describes a system’s ability to operate and maintain its functionality without relying on external centralized infrastructure or control. This property is fundamental to decentralized networks, ensuring resilience against single points of failure or external censorship. It guarantees that the network’s core operations remain self-sufficient. This characteristic is a key security feature for blockchain systems.
